MTV launches the 'second British invasion'
The influence of MTV on the pop world is worthy of a tome in itself, but its initial impact was especially intriguing. During the station's early days they relied heavily on video-savvy British acts to fill airtime. This played a huge part in the "second British invasion", where groups such as Eurythmics and A Flock of Seagulls scored hits across the Atlantic. It took the "I want my MTV" campaign before MTV finally got its hands on New York and LA audiences, eventually growing into the behemoth it is today.
